[32], Horace Grant expressed a belief that the documentary was edited to favor Jordan, remarking that the series was "entertaining, but we know [...] that about 90% of it [was] BS in terms of the realness of it"; he also denied Jordan's accusation that Grant was the source for The Jordan Rules and agreed that Pippen was portrayed unfairly. [33] Craig Hodges, who was not interviewed for the documentary, was "bothered" by Jordan's comments about the team's use of cocaine during the 1980s, remarking, "I was thinking about the brothers who [were on the team] with you who have to explain [what happened] to their families". An enterprising executive at NBA Entertainment at the time, NBA Commissioner Adam Silver helped facilitate the behind-the-scenes access during that season with then-coach Phil Jackson, Michael Jordan and Bulls owner Jerry Reinsdorf all signing off with the understanding it would be pulled out when the time was right. The team entered the season knowing it would be their last together. Jordan advisors Estee Portnoy and Curtis Polk from The Jump 23 — his business enterprise that is also a partner on the project with ESPN, Netflix, the NBA and Tollin's Mandalay Sports Media — sent a letter to the other participants, encouraging the star-studded list of subjects to be open as possible.
